注册 登录
编程论坛 C++教室

请各位帮我看看这程式!!

phssub 发布于 2013-08-02 18:17, 511 次点击
请问错误的地方要如何修改??? 执行结果是什么???
#include <dos.h>
void write_CMOS(unsigned char index, unsigned char data)
{
outportb(0x70, index);
outportb(0x71, data);
}
void main()
{
/* write data 0FF Hex to index 6C Hex of CMOS RAM*/
write_CMOS(0x6C, 0xff);
/* read data from index 6B Hex of CMOS RAM*/
outportb(0x70, 0x6B);
inportb(0x71);
}
5 回复
#2
peach54602013-08-02 19:59
错误是虾米?
#3
天使梦魔2013-08-02 22:52
这是个人提供的sdk?翻译你的注解:
第一个,写数据十六进制0FF到CMOS内存里的头部偏移6C地方
第二个,读取来自CMOS内存里头部偏移6B的数据

函数很普通,谁知道谁做的这个
#4
wp2319572013-08-03 06:47
#include <dos.h>
仅仅第一行代码  就足够说明这段代码没有任何学习价值了
#5
peach54602013-08-03 06:49
回复 4楼 wp231957
我只是进来打酱油的,哈哈...
双休你也起得够早的呀...
#6
wp2319572013-08-03 07:06
回复 5楼 peach5460
早上出去转了一圈  嘿嘿
1